Transaction 85115341d59ec22b5336e0cdd954626340c071e6cd425d871ddd26ae6f402485

1 Input
2 Outputs
  • 85115341d59ec22b5336e0cdd954626340c071e6cd425d871ddd26ae6f402485:0
  • value  876583
    address  12WFbKY5ZLJ6m1NV6r71E3npXK51vrEvtb
  • 85115341d59ec22b5336e0cdd954626340c071e6cd425d871ddd26ae6f402485:1
  • value  1699
    address  3JaAkAT7uNGgQmeJnLthek67MxUVSvdjsx